How Innovation Improves Employee Well-being in Remote and Hybrid Work

1. Virtual Team-building Activities and Social Tools

Virtual team-building activities and social tools are a game-changer for remote teams. Employers should schedule regular online events to keep the team spirit alive. Employees can use these platforms to chat with their coworkers, brainstorm, and have fun together.

Tip: Organize a monthly virtual game night or happy hour.

2. Mental Health Apps and Resources

Mental health apps are a godsend for remote workers needing support and stress relief. Employers can offer subscriptions to these apps as part of their employee benefits package. Employees should take advantage of these tools to stay mentally fit.

Tip: Try a mindfulness app for daily meditation sessions.

3. Ergonomic and Adaptive Home Office Solutions

Ergonomic and adaptive home office solutions are making it easier for remote workers to stay comfy and productive. Employers can provide stipends for ergonomic office equipment. Employees should invest in adjustable desks, ergonomic chairs, and other helpful tools.

Tip: Set up a home office with proper ergonomics in mind.

4. Balancing Work-Life Integration with Innovative Tools and Strategies

Cool tools and strategies help remote workers find a healthy balance between work and life. Employers should encourage flexible work schedules, and employees can use time management apps to stay organized.

Tip: Plan your day with a time management app to keep work and personal life in harmony.

The Challenges & Downsides of Innovation in Remote & Hybrid Work

1. Digital Divide and Unequal Access to Resources

Not everyone has equal access to tech and resources for remote work. Employers should ensure all employees have the necessary equipment, and employees can help bridge the gap by sharing resources and knowledge.

Tip: Create a company program to provide technical support for employees in need.

2. Online Security Risks and Cyber Threats

Remote work can come with increased online security risks. Employers should invest in cybersecurity measures and train employees on best practices for staying safe online.

Tip: Conduct regular cybersecurity training for your team.

3. Over-reliance on Technology and Potential for Burnout

Too much screen time can lead to burnout. Employers should promote healthy boundaries, and employees should take breaks and set limits on their tech usage.

Tip: Schedule screen-free breaks throughout the day.

4. Preserving Company Culture and Team Cohesion

Maintaining a strong company culture can be tricky with remote teams. Employers should prioritize team-building activities and open communication, while employees can actively engage with their coworkers to stay connected.

Tip: Host a virtual town hall meeting to discuss company values and goals.
